MATTER OF LUKE


65 A.D.3d 550 (2009)

882 N.Y.S.2d 912

In the Matter of LUKE, an Infant. FLORENCE C., Respondent; VICTORIA M., Appellant.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York, Second Department.

Decided August 4, 2009.


Ordered that the order is affirmed, without costs and disbursements.
